发明名称 HIGHLY QUENCHABLE Fe-BASED RARE EARTH MATERIAL FOR FERRITE REPLACEMENT
摘要 <P>PROBLEM TO BE SOLVED: To provide a highly quenchable Fe-based rare earth magnetic material that is manufactured by a rapid solidification process and exhibits good magnetic characteristics and thermal stability. <P>SOLUTION: This application relates to an isotropic Nd-Fe-B type magnetic material manufactured by a rapid solidification process having a lower optimal wheel speed and a broader optimal wheel speed window than those used in manufacturing a magnetic material. The material exhibits remanence (B<SB>r</SB>) and intrinsic coercivity (H<SB>ci</SB>) values of between 7.0 to 8.5 kG and 6.5 to 9.9 kOe, respectively, at room temperature. The application also relates to a method of manufacturing the material and to a bonded magnet manufactured from the magnetic material, which is suitable for direct replacement of anisotropic sintered ferrite in many applications. <P>COPYRIGHT: (C)2011,JPO&INPIT
